For sales leads. Effective next quarter, legacy customers on the Fenwick Suite pre-2021 plans move to current list pricing, phased over two billing cycles. Roughly 340 accounts affected; average uplift is 14%. Retention modelling predicts churn of 4–6%, concentrated in the smallest tier. Talk tracks and exception criteria will be distributed before announcement. Escalations route through regional directors only; no ad-hoc discounting. The underlying commercial reasoning, which must not be shared externally, is summarised below.

confidential, kagup-bafog: Fraaxax Group is in early talks to buy Soroxox Group for about $343.8 million. The Olidor launch date is June 14, and nothing goes to the press before then. Legal wants the Aldmirek Logistics term sheet signed before July 23.

## Configuration

Fenwick Sheets streams spreadsheet exports to keep memory flat; plugins that buffer rows will see the old spikes return. Set `EXPORT_STREAM_CHUNK` conservatively and test against large workbooks. Streaming mode also requires authenticating to the export relay, so ensure your env file contains the following line.

sealed setting: VAULT_KEY20=69e2a0b23f1a79fbf692

**Ticket PARITY-412: Kestrel SDK catch-up**

Quick one for the weekly sync: the Kestrel-Go SDK is still missing batched uploads and retry hints that Kestrel-JS shipped two releases ago. Partner teams keep asking. Plan is to land both behind a flag this sprint and cut a minor release. Needs a sign-off from the owner named below.

account owner for bajef-badup: Drueth Kelath Pelael Holwyn